'55, EDITH BURNAP THOMPSON Art Adviser ISS THOMPSON, with her singular ability to make the best of any difficult situation, has successfully guided the Art Staff of the RECORD BooK through the trying condi- tions which resulted from the emergency shortage of materials. The encouragement which she has offered to the staff will be long remembered and Will continue to instill confidence in those who have been fortunate enough to have worked with her. Her suggestions were so subtly offered that the staff completed their work feeling that they had had the individual opportunity to create something worthwhile under an inspiring leader. Best of all, she has shown them that a jolly disposition combined with infinite tact and conscientious devotion to the task at hand can make the hardest problem a genuine pleasure to solve. 16
